Best Sewing Machine: Buyer's Guide

Selecting the right sewing machine involves careful consideration of various factors, including project type, budget, skill level, and desired features. For example, a quilter might prioritize a machine with a large throat space and a wide variety of stitching options, while a beginner might prefer a basic, easy-to-use model.

A well-chosen machine can significantly enhance project outcomes, offering precision, efficiency, and the ability to tackle complex tasks. From basic garment construction to intricate embroidery, the appropriate machine can elevate craftsmanship and unlock creative potential. The evolution of these machines from basic mechanical devices to sophisticated computerized systems reflects their enduring importance in textile arts and manufacturing.

7+ Molecular Effects of Growth Hormone on Target Cells: A Deep Dive

Understanding the comprehensive impact of growth hormone at the cellular level requires examining its interactions with specific molecules within target cells. This involves investigating how the hormone binds to receptors, triggers intracellular signaling cascades, and ultimately influences gene expression and protein synthesis. For instance, analyzing changes in protein phosphorylation, second messenger levels, and the activation of specific transcription factors provides insights into the mechanisms by which growth hormone exerts its anabolic and metabolic effects.

Elucidating the detailed actions of growth hormone on a molecular level is crucial for comprehending its diverse physiological roles in growth, development, and metabolism. This knowledge base is fundamental for developing targeted therapies for growth disorders, optimizing treatment strategies, and understanding the potential consequences of growth hormone dysregulation. Historically, research in this area has progressed from identifying the hormone itself to characterizing its receptor and downstream signaling pathways, gradually unveiling the intricate network of molecular events underlying its biological activity.
